Transaction e0090db21d7a197cc19250b68de3999d0d38ff952912c1a71f31bf2a83c1d8a7
1 Input
1 Output
-
e0090db21d7a197cc19250b68de3999d0d38ff952912c1a71f31bf2a83c1d8a7:0
- value
- 662222
- script pubkey
- OP_0 OP_PUSHBYTES_20 f865c9ecd46d42f793088159612b74a5afe871df
- address
- bc1qlpjunmx5d4p00ycgs9vkz2m55kh7suwle4dkfk